Origin and history

The Volcano Museum in Aurillac is a monument located in the city of Aurillac, in the Auvergne-Rhône-Alpes region. This place is dedicated to the discovery of volcanoes, a central theme in this region marked by historical volcanic activity. Although the exact period of its creation is not mentioned, its existence is part of a desire to develop the local geological heritage.

The Auvergne-Rhône-Alpes region, known for its volcanic landscapes, has always been a territory where geology plays a major role in cultural and economic identity. Museums such as Aurillac's make it possible to raise public awareness of the importance of volcanoes, while providing an educational and tourist space.
